Football clubs' communication offices are increasingly important for what echoes in the media about their teams. This article has, therefore, two central objectives. Firstly, a literature review aims to understand the importance of communication in sports. Then, it is also the purpose of the text to understand if the media influence the communication strategies of Futebol Clube do Porto (FCP) from the perception of their supporters.
The analysis uses qualitative and quantitative techniques, such as exploratory interviews with journalists and FCP communication elements and applying a questionnaire survey to a non-probabilistic convenience sample to accomplish these objectives.
